Abstract
Изобретение относится к самофлюсующимся заготовкам для пайки. Заготовка содержит композиционный материал, содержащий по меньшей мере один неорганический материал, распределенный в матрице металла или сплава металла, причем неорганический материал образует при пайке флюс, способствуя образованию термически индуцированного металлического связующего слоя. Матрица может представлять собой алюминиево-кремниевый припой, а неорганический материал может представлять собой флюс фтороалюмината калия. Заготовку изготавливают путем струйного формования.
